DANIEL OREADI Born in Boston and raised in Venezuela, Dr. Oreadi is currently an Associate Professor in the Department of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ery at Tufts University and a dedicated staff member at Tufts Medical Center, where he holds operating room privileges. Dr. Oreadi received his dental degree from Universidad Central ofVenezuela before returning to the U.S. He gained initial surgical experiencethrough internships in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ery at Boston University andTufts University. He completed his advanced education training in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ery at Tufts University and Tufts Medical Center in 2009. Demonstrating a commitment to sub-specialization, he then completed a yearlong fellowship in Head and Neck Oncologic and Reconstructive Surgery at the University of Tennessee Medical Center in Knoxville, TN.
